Description Credal AI offers an enterprise-grade platform designed for securely deploying and managing AI agents, specifically tailored for organizations handling sensitive internal data. It enables businesses to leverage large language models (LLMs) with their proprietary information while ensuring robust data security, compliance with regulations like HIPAA and GDPR, and comprehensive governance. The platform empowers enterprises to build and operate AI agents that can access internal knowledge bases without risking data leakage or non-compliance, making it ideal for highly regulated industries. Cyber Upgrade is an expert cybersecurity and compliance platform specifically engineered for financial firms navigating the complexities of regulatory adherence. It provides a comprehensive suite of tools designed to help financial entities achieve and maintain DORA (Digital Operational Resilience Act) compliance, ensuring robust operational resilience and cybersecurity practices. The platform streamlines risk management, incident response, and third-party oversight, acting as a critical solution for regulated institutions.
What It Does Credal AI provides a secure environment for connecting AI agents to an organization's internal data sources, such as CRMs, ERPs, and document repositories. It facilitates the deployment, orchestration, and monitoring of these agents, ensuring that all interactions and data processing adhere to strict security policies and regulatory requirements. The platform effectively mitigates risks associated with AI adoption by implementing features like data anonymization, granular access controls, and audit trails. The platform automates and centralizes the management of cybersecurity and operational resilience requirements, with a strong focus on DORA. It enables financial firms to identify, assess, and mitigate risks, manage third-party vendor exposures, and orchestrate incident response workflows. By providing continuous monitoring and detailed reporting, Cyber Upgrade helps organizations proactively maintain their compliance posture and enhance overall security.

Who is Credal AI best for?

Credal AI is primarily designed for large enterprises and organizations operating in highly regulated industries such as finance, healthcare, legal, and government. It caters to roles like AI/ML engineers, data security officers, compliance teams, IT managers, and business leaders who need to deploy AI responsibly and securely within their existing infrastructure.

Who is Cyber Upgrade best for?

This tool is primarily designed for financial institutions, including banks, investment firms, and insurance companies, particularly those operating within the European Union's regulatory scope. Key beneficiaries include Chief Information Security Officers (CISOs), Compliance Officers, Risk Managers, and IT Directors responsible for cybersecurity and operational resilience.
